Five Immunity Boosting Foods

Summer is approaching and the hot scorching sun tends to eat away all the energy in one go, making kids vulnerable to catching various diseases such as common cold, diarrhea, natsubate or summer fatigue. Also, due to the ongoing pandemic, the thought of catching infections and flu constantly lurks at the back of the mind and concern grows even greater! To keep your kids healthy, powerful antioxidants rich in Vitamin C are necessary! Keeping them hydrated all the time, consumption of green vegetables and loading up nuts daily are some preventive measures.

Immunity boosting foods that your children should consume:

1) Turmeric

Turmeric helps to enhance immune system’s responses to infections and is a great immunity booster! A pinch of turmeric to milk works as a great tonic. Drinking turmeric milk on regular basis provides immunity against cold, flu and allergies as it has antiviral properties. Adding some saffron, further enhances the healing properties of the milk.

2) Citrus Crush

Vitamin C tends to slow down cell damage and heal wounds, in addition to protecting body against disease. To help your child get vitamin C, offer them seasonal fruits such as guava, oranges, kiwi and jamun. Other good sources of vitamin C include baked potatoes and broccoli.

3) Get Nutty

Kids can get fussy about fruits and vegetables sometimes but they may like to eat crunchy dry fruits and nuts like walnuts, cashews and almonds. To amuse them, you can even make a trial mix of them! They can be consumed in any form, dry or roasted. Walnuts, raisins, dates and almonds are good sources of vitamins and antioxidants. They are rich in protein and are sources of good fats which ensures that the energy level of your kid is always high!

4) Dairy Dip

Vitamin D also helps in boosting the immune system strong besides helping to build the bones and keeping them strong! One of the best sources of vitamin D is milk! If your kids do not get pleased at drinking milk, you can try giving them smoothies, milkshakes and fruit yogurt! This breaks the monotony of gulping the big glass of milk and providing immunity boost!

5) E-Rich Foods

With vitamin C and vitamin D, the body needs vitamin E as well! It helps to fight off bacteria and viruses, also protecting your kid’s cells and tissues from damage! For E-rich foods, stock up on whole grains, nuts, seeds, oats and green leafy vegetables such as spinach and broccoli. To make this ingredients kid-palatable, you can serve oatmeal with cinnamon and honey, a whole grain toast with jam or peanut butter or maybe a steamed broccoli with melted cheese!

Make the most of this season and keep your kids safe and energized with this nutritious food that will strengthen their immunity!
